In this embodiment, a rectangular groove is formed at the side end of the filter box 1, the filter plate 13 is inserted into the rectangular groove, and the sealing plate 7 with a handle seals the rectangular groove.
In this embodiment, the scraping mechanism comprises a scraping plate 11 and a transmission mechanism for driving the scraping plate 11 to move, and the scraping plate 11 is perpendicular to the filtering plate 13 and contacts with the top of the filtering plate 13.
In the embodiment, the transmission mechanism comprises a screw shaft 6 which is connected to the inner wall of the filter box 1 through a bearing and is in threaded connection with the top of the scraper 11;
a worm gear 10 fixedly mounted on one end of the screw shaft 6; and
and a worm shaft 8 vertically penetrating the top plate 3 and engaged with the worm wheel 10.
In the embodiment, one end of the worm shaft 8 is mounted on a mounting plate 9 preset on the inner wall of the filter tank 1 through a bearing, the other end passes through the top plate 3 to be in bearing connection with the top plate 3, and a hand wheel 5 is fixedly mounted on the end.
In this embodiment, a guide post 12 parallel to the screw shaft 6 is further fixedly installed inside the filter box 1, and the top of the scraper 11 passes through the guide post 12 and keeps sliding.
During filtration, firstly, the filter plate 13 is inserted into a rectangular groove at the side end of the filter box 1 and sealed by the sealing plate 7 with the handle, meanwhile, the material receiving barrel is placed at the lower end of a discharge port at the bottom of the filter box 1, then oil to be filtered is poured into the filter box 1 from the feed hopper 4 to be filtered, when the filtering speed is slowed down, the hand wheel 5 can be rotated by workers to drive the worm shaft 8 and the worm wheel 10 to move in a matched manner, so that the screw shaft 6 is driven to rotate, the scraper 11 and the screw shaft 6 are in a threaded connection manner, so that the scraper can be driven to move linearly, the filter plate 13 is cleaned, meanwhile, the scraper 11 scrapes oil residues to extrude the inner wall of the filter box 1, the filtering quality can also be improved, and after the filtration is finished, the sealing plate 7 with the handle is taken down and the filter plate 13 is taken out to clean.
